Electrolyzers are electrochemical systems designed to split water into hydrogen and oxygen using electricity, serving as a cornerstone in the transition to a low-carbon hydrogen economy. These devices range from small-scale proton exchange membrane (PEM) units to large alkaline and solid oxide configurations, each offering unique advantages such as high efficiency, rapid response times, and modular scalability. The need for clean hydrogen production has never been greater, driven by stringent carbon-emission targets and growing demand in industries like refining, ammonia synthesis, and fuel cell vehicles.

Electrolyzer Market enable integration with intermittent renewable energy sources—solar PV and wind farms—turning surplus electricity into storable fuel. This flexibility addresses grid instability and supports decarbonization efforts, unlocking significant market opportunities in both established and emerging regions. Continuous improvements in electrode materials, system design, and balance-of-plant components are reducing capital expenditures and increasing system lifespans, enhancing the overall market growth trajectory. Key Takeaways


Key players operating in the Electrolyzer Market are:

-Nel Hydrogen

-Asahi Kasei Corporation

-Hydrogenics Corporation

-Shandong Saikesaisi Hydrogen Energy Co., Ltd.

-Teledyne Energy Systems

These market players are investing heavily in R&D to improve stack durability, increase system efficiency, and lower production costs. Nel Hydrogen has leveraged its long-standing expertise to secure large-scale contracts in Europe, while Asahi Kasei Corporation focuses on membrane innovations to enhance PEM performance. Hydrogenics Corporation, now part of Cummins Inc., benefits from synergies in fuel cell and electrolyzer integration, boosting its market share. Shandong Saikesaisi Hydrogen Energy Co., Ltd. is expanding manufacturing capacity to serve the Asia-Pacific region, and Teledyne Energy Systems is known for its compact solutions tailored to remote and off-grid applications. Collectively, these market companies are shaping industry trends through strategic partnerships, licensing agreements, and targeted acquisitions.

Rising global decarbonization initiatives, coupled with electrification of heavy industries, are driving growing demand for electrolyzer technologies. Industrial gas suppliers and utilities view green hydrogen as a solution for balancing supply and demand on modern grids, creating substantial market opportunities. The transport sector’s shift to fuel cell electric vehicles (FCEVs) and hydrogen trains further accentuates the need for robust electrolyzer capacity. New market segments, such as hydrogen refueling stations and power-to-X applications—including synthetic fuels and chemical production—are emerging, broadening the industry scope. Analysts anticipate that favorable policies, carbon pricing mechanisms, and off-taker agreements will sustain the market’s strong market growth trajectory, while continuous market insights point to declining levelized cost of hydrogen (LCOH) through economies of scale and technological advancements.
